Questions sur binary

30
réponses

Comment compter le nombre de bits d'un entier de 32 bits?

8 bits représentant le nombre 7 ressemblent à ceci: 00000111 trois bits sont mis. Quels sont les algorithmes pour déterminer le nombre de bits définis dans un entier de 32 bits?
demandé sur 2008-09-20 23:04:38
7
réponses

Que fait le caractère " b " devant une chaîne littérale?

apparemment, la syntaxe suivante est valide my_string = b'The string' j'aimerais savoir: qu ... où dans ce document. aussi, juste par curiosité, y a-t-il plus de symboles que b et u qui font autre chose?
demandé sur 2011-06-07 22:14:52
17
réponses

Qu'est-ce que le"complément 2"?

je suis en systèmes informatiques, et avoir été "151910920 du" mal , en partie, avec Complément à Deux . Je v ... t. ce que j'espère c'est une définition claire et concise qui est facilement comprise par un programmeur.
demandé sur 2009-06-26 19:21:38
14
réponses

Qu'est-ce qu'une interface binaire d'application (ABI)?

Je n'ai jamais compris ce qu'est un ABI. S'il vous plaît, ne me montrez pas un article de Wikipédia. Si je pouvais le ... ù puis-je trouver Microsoft Windows' ABI? ainsi, ce sont les principales requêtes qui sont écoute-moi.
demandé sur 2010-01-31 12:30:24
6
réponses

Comment exprimez-vous les littérales binaires en Python?

Comment exprimez-vous un entier comme un nombre binaire avec Python littéraux? j'ai été capable de trouver la ... un octal. Python 3.0 beta: identique à 2.6, mais ne permettra plus l'ancienne syntaxe 027 pour les octals.
demandé sur 2008-08-04 22:20:36
12
réponses

Pourquoi utilisons-nous Base64?

Wikipedia says Base64 les schémas d'encodage sont couramment utilisés lorsqu'il est nécessaire d'enco ... de la manière prévue, même si le destinataire a des interprétations différentes pour le reste du jeu de caractères.
demandé sur 2010-08-21 19:21:08
19
réponses

Puis-je utiliser un binaire littéral en C ou C++?

j'ai besoin de travailler avec un nombre binaire. j'ai essayé d'écrire: const x = 00010000; ma ... il y a un type en C++ pour les nombres binaires et s'il n'y en a pas, y a-t-il une autre solution pour mon problème?
demandé sur 2010-04-10 04:35:10
18
réponses

Pourquoi préférer le complément de deux au signe-et-magnitude pour les numéros signés?

je suis juste curieux s'il y a une raison pour laquelle afin de représenter -1 en binaire, le complément de two est ut ... ier bit comme drapeau négatif. avertissement: Je ne compte pas sur l'arithmétique binaire pour mon travail!
demandé sur 2009-07-14 17:15:08
6
réponses

Comment convertir une chaîne de caractères ou un entier en binaire en Ruby?

comment créer des entiers 0..9 et les opérateurs de mathématiques + - * / dans les chaînes binaires. Par exemple: ... 000, 1 = 0001, ... 9 = 1001 y a-t-il un moyen de le faire avec Ruby 1.8.6 sans utiliser de bibliothèque?
demandé sur 2010-02-26 08:35:36
19
réponses

Est-il sûr d'utiliser -1 pour mettre tous les bits à true?

j'ai vu ce modèle beaucoup utilisé en C & C++. unsigned int flags = -1; // all bits are true est-ce une bonne façon portable pour accomplir ceci? Ou est-il préférable d'utiliser 0xffffffff ou ~0 ?
demandé sur 2009-05-01 01:37:02
8
réponses

Outil pour comparer 2 fichiers binaires dans Windows [fermé]

j'ai besoin d'un outil pour comparer 2 fichiers binaires. Les dossiers sont assez gros. Certains freeware ou des outil ... ouvés sur internet ne sont pas pratiques à utiliser pour les grands fichiers. Pouvez-vous me recommander des outils?
demandé sur 2011-11-17 15:56:23
10
réponses

Pourquoi ne Git traiter ce fichier texte dans un fichier binaire?

je me demande pourquoi git me dit ceci:? $ git diff MyFile.txt diff --git a/MyFile.txt b/MyFile.txt index d41a4 ... [email protected] 1 nacho4d staff 746 28 Jul 17:07 MyFile.txt -rw-r--r-- 1 nacho4d staff 22538 5 Apr 16:18 OtherFile.txt
demandé sur 2011-07-28 11:55:47
11
réponses

Sont les opérateurs de décalage (

En C, sont les opérateurs de décalage ( << , >> ) arithmétique ou logique?
demandé sur 2008-08-11 12:55:13
13
réponses

Comment intégrer des données binaires dans XML?

j'ai deux applications écrites en Java qui communiquent entre elles en utilisant des messages XML sur le réseau. J'ut ... Base64 de la bibliothèque apache commons codec , au cas où quelqu'un d'autre essaie quelque chose de similaire.
demandé sur 2008-08-21 17:35:46
8
réponses

Convertir décimal en binaire en python [dupliquer]

cette question a déjà une réponse ici: Python int à binaire? ... nt int ('[binary_value]', 2), donc de n'importe quelle façon faire l'inverse sans écrire le code. le faire moi-même?
demandé sur 2010-08-20 08:13:12
15
réponses

Comment obtenir une représentation binaire 0-padded d'un entier en java?

par exemple, pour 1, 2, 128, 256 la sortie peut être (16 chiffres): 0000000000000001 0000000000000010 0000000 ... décrit comment formater des entiers avec le 0-padding gauche, mais il n'est pas pour la représentation binaire.
demandé sur 2010-12-12 14:30:59
9
réponses

Est-ce que ((A + (b & 255)) & 255) est le même que ((A + b) & 255)?

je naviguais sur du code C++, et j'ai trouvé quelque chose comme ça: (a + (b & 255)) & 255 le d ... en, Je n'ai aucune idée de ce que je fais . aussi, désolé pour le titre Lisp-Y. N'hésitez pas à modifier.
demandé sur 2016-11-23 00:09:03
15
réponses

Fonctionnement et utilisation en bits

considérez ce code: x = 1 # 0001 x << 2 # Shift left 2 bits: 0100 # Result: 4 x | 2 ... par ailleurs, dans quel cas les opérateurs bitwise sont-ils réellement utilisés? J'apprécierais quelques exemples.
demandé sur 2009-11-17 07:37:05
8
réponses

En Java, puis-je définir une constante entière en format binaire?

similaire à comment vous pouvez définir une constante entière en hexadécimal ou octal, puis-je le faire en binaire? je reconnais que c'est une question très facile (et stupide). Mes recherches sur google sont en train vide.
demandé sur 2009-05-15 11:14:56
8
réponses

Comment supprimer des objets non utilisés d'un dépôt git?

j'ai accidentellement ajouté, engagé et poussé un énorme fichier binaire avec ma toute dernière propagation vers un dé ... cts: 100% (625/625), done. Total 625 (delta 351), reused 0 (delta 0) $ du -hs .git 174M .git $ # still 175 MB :-(
demandé sur 2010-09-26 17:08:35
10
réponses

Comment les entiers sont-ils représentés en interne au niveau bit en Java?

j'essaie de comprendre comment Java stocke integer en interne. Je sais que tous les entiers primitifs de java sont sig ... dans le complément de two et une réponse dit que seuls les nombres négatifs sont stockés dans le complément de two.
demandé sur 2012-11-16 22:22:40
8
réponses

Comment convertir une chaîne binaire en un entier de base 10 en Java

j'ai un tableau de chaînes qui représentent des nombres binaires (sans zéros de tête) que je veux convertir en leur ba ... e les zéros de tête ou l'absence de celui-ci sera un problème. N'importe qui ont des bonnes directions à m'indiquer?
demandé sur 2012-04-16 21:45:39
9
réponses

protocoles binaires v. protocoles de texte

quelqu'un aurait-il une bonne définition de ce qu'est un protocole binaire est? et qu'est ce qu'un protocole texte en ... tous les commentaires sont favorables, j'essaie d'en venir à l'essence des choses ici. salutations!
demandé sur 2010-04-15 16:06:07
24
réponses

Pourquoi devrais-je utiliser un format de fichier lisible par l'homme?

Pourquoi devrais-je utiliser un format de fichier lisible par l'homme, de préférence à un binaire? Est-il jamais une s ... mme est une bonne idée. Ensuite, j'ai cherché pour l'un, et ne pouvait pas en trouver un. Alors voici la question
demandé sur 2009-02-20 11:08:53
5
réponses

Comment créer des patches binaires?

Quelle est la meilleure façon de faire un patch pour un fichier binaire? Je veux qu'il soit simple pour les utilisateu ... ne application simple patch serait agréable). Exécuter diff sur le fichier donne juste Binary files [...] differ
demandé sur 2009-12-22 12:03:39
21
réponses

C++ - conversion décimale en binaire

j'ai écrit un programme 'simple' (il m'a fallu 30 minutes) qui convertit le nombre décimal en binaire. Je suis sûr qu' ... std::string toBinary(int n) { std::string r; while(n!=0) {r=(n%2==0 ?"0":"1")+r; n/=2;} return r; }
demandé sur 2014-03-30 20:20:30
9
réponses

Convertir la chaîne de caractères en binaire puis revenir en utilisant PHP

y a-t-il un moyen de convertir une chaîne en binaire puis de revenir dans la bibliothèque PHP standard? pour ... n. Semble hachage et sortie en binaire en même temps. http://php.net/manual/en/function.hash-hmac.php
demandé sur 2011-06-17 11:36:39
10
réponses

Est-il un moyen de lire des données binaires en JavaScript?

je voudrais injecter des données binaires dans un objet en JavaScript. Est-il un moyen de faire cela? i.e. var binObj = new BinaryObject('101010100101011'); quelque Chose à cet effet. Toute aide serait super.
demandé sur 2008-11-29 19:43:32
9
réponses

L'analyse d'un fichier binaire. Ce qui est une manière moderne?

j'ai un fichier binaire avec une mise en page que je connais. Par exemple, que le format soit comme ceci: 2 ... ngueur des données de la chaîne et du flotteur n'est pas connue au moment de la compilation et qu'elle est variable.
demandé sur 2014-11-10 17:00:26
4
réponses

Intégration de blobs binaires en utilisant gcc mingw

j'essaie d'intégrer des blobs binaires dans un fichier exe. J'utilise mingw gcc. je fais le fichier objet com ... ours: undefined reference to _binary_input_txt_start est-ce que quelqu'un sait ce que je fais de mal?
demandé sur 2010-04-13 08:38:33